(a)Consistent with the requirements of this section, identification procedures, including fingerprinting, shall be established for prisoners confined in local correctional facilities.
(b)All prisoner fingerprints shall be taken in accordance with the rules and methods prescribed by the Division of Criminal Justice Services. If the prisoner is sentenced for a felony or a misdemeanor, two copies of the prisoner's fingerprints shall be forwarded by the facility to the Division of Criminal Justice Services within 24 hours of the admission of such sentenced prisoner to the facility. One copy of such fingerprints shall be retained by the facility.
(c)When deemed necessary to maintain the safety and security of the facility, the chief administrative officer may:
(1)take the fingerprints of unsentenced prisoners; or
(2)take palmprints or a photograph of any prisoner.
